Troy took 2-of-3 this weekend at New Orleans, losing the first one and winning the second. The bats really were alive all series, and the pitching was hit or miss. Travis Burge, who couldn’t get out of the first inning in Sunday’s 19-8 Troy win, will start Tuesday’s 6 p.m. against Southern Miss. Troy is now 15-10, 4-5 in league play with a very winnable series at Arkansas State this weekend. Checking the stats, Brett Henry leads the team with a .378 average, and Ryan Ditthardt is the top run-producer with 7 homers and 34 RBIs with a .376 average. The pitching ERAs could come down, but a 4.96 team ERA in the metal bat era is decent.

Southern Miss brings a 16-9 record to Troy this week and will be one of the better teams Troy hosts this year. Golden Eagles scored 51 in three games at UCF last weekend. Get caught up with USM baseball HERE.

Looking at the Sun Belt standings, Middle Tennessee and Western Kentucky are dominating. MTSU is 11-1 in league play and WKU, which had its bye from league play last week, is 8-1. Troy is sixth at 4-5.

Also, for the Sun Belt-leading softball Trojans, Ashlyn Williams was named SBC Pitcher of the Week for her efforts in Troy’s sweep of Western Kentucky.
